Outline of Final Research Achievements

Analysis of induction of B404-class antibodies, which neutralize various SIV strains, was performed using 6 SIV-infected macaques. Induction of B404-class antibodies was associated with polymorphism of immunoglobulin Heavy chain gene, and macaques with the VH3.33 allele with E at 38th position and T at 65th position induced B404-class antibodies. The 38E was important for binding to Env and neutralizing activity. These results suggest that induction of neutralizing antibodies is determined by polymorphism of immunoglobulin genes.

Academic Significance and Societal Importance of the Research Achievements

近年、多様なHIV-1株を広範に中和するbnAbの誘導が効果的なワクチンの開発に重要であると考えられるようになった。また、特定のbnAbを誘導するための抗原の開発も進んでいる。しかしながら、HIV-1感染によるbnAbの誘導は稀であり、そのメカニズムも不明である。本研究では、SIV感染サル・モデルを用いて中和抗体誘導の解析を行い、中和抗体の誘導と抗体遺伝子の多型が密接に関連していることを示した。この結果は、今後のワクチン開発に遺伝子多型を考慮する必要があることをあきらかにした。
